The client faces difficulties in accurately measuring passenger traffic density and flow between different areas, including peak times and crowded locations. This hampers effective route optimization, scheduling, and resource allocation. They lack a comprehensive, low-cost solution to gather real-time traffic and passenger engagement data from smartphones and transit vehicle signals.
A municipal transportation authority or transit provider seeking to optimize route planning, bus stops, and scheduling through passenger traffic analytics.
The proposed system is expected to significantly improve the accuracy of passenger traffic data, enabling the client to optimize bus routes, stops, and schedules with greater precision. This will enhance operational efficiency, reduce congestion, and improve passenger service quality. The solution's scalability and low-cost infrastructure will facilitate large-scale deployment, with the potential for city-wide analytics and smarter transit planning, ultimately leading to more informed decision-making and resource allocation.
